程序段中的PLC中断服务探讨 (程序段中的p表示什么)

程序段中的PLC中断服务与PLC中断中p的意义探讨 程序段中的p表示什么

一、引言

在现代工业控制系统中,PLC(可编程逻辑控制器)扮演着至关重要的角色。
随着技术的不断进步,PLC的应用范围越来越广泛,对其性能的要求也越来越高。
中断服务是PLC中的重要功能之一,对于提高系统的实时性和响应速度具有重要意义。
而在PLC中断服务中,程序段中的p具有特定的含义和作用。
本文将探讨程序段中的PLC中断服务及其中的p的含义。

二、PLC中断服务概述

PLC中断服务是指当PLC接收到外部或内部触发信号时,暂停当前正在执行的程序,转而执行预先设定的中断服务程序。
这些触发信号可能来自输入信号的变化、定时器中断、通信中断等。
中断服务能够提高PLC的响应速度,使其在处理实时任务时具有更高的灵活性。

在PLC中断服务中,程序通常被划分为多个程序段。
每个程序段执行特定的任务,并且可以在中断服务中被调用或跳转。
这种结构使得PLC能够同时处理多个任务,提高系统的整体性能。

三、程序段中的p的含义

在PLC中断服务中,程序段中的p通常代表“指针”(pointer)或“位置”(position)。
具体含义取决于上下文环境和PLC的编程语言。

1. 作为指针(pointer):在PLC程序中,p可能用于指示数据在内存中的位置或引用某个特定的数据元素。当PLC接收到中断信号时,程序可能会跳转到由p指定的程序段,以执行特定的中断服务程序。
2. 作为位置(position):在某些情况下,p可能代表某个设备或传感器在系统中的位置。当发生中断时,p所指示的位置信息可能会被用于控制相应的设备或进行数据处理。

四、PLC中断服务的实现与p的作用

在PLC中断服务的实现过程中,p扮演着重要的角色。以下是p在PLC中断服务中的具体作用:

1. 跳转执行:当PLC接收到中断信号时,根据p所指示的位置或指针,程序可以跳转到相应的程序段执行中断服务。这有助于提高系统的响应速度和处理实时任务的能力。
2. 数据处理:在中断服务中,p可以用于引用内存中的数据或指示数据的位置。通过读取和修改这些数据,PLC可以实现对设备的控制或完成特定的数据处理任务。
3. 设备控制:如果p代表设备的位置或状态,那么在中断服务中,PLC可以根据p所指示的信息对设备进行适当的控制。例如,当某个设备出现故障或达到特定位置时,PLC可以通过中断服务进行相应的处理,如停机、报警等。

五、优化PLC中断服务与提高p的使用效率

为了优化PLC中断服务并提高p的使用效率,可以采取以下措施:

1. 合理规划程序结构:将PLC程序划分为多个独立的程序段,并为每个程序段分配特定的任务。这样,在中断发生时,可以迅速跳转到相应的程序段执行中断服务。
2. 优化中断处理逻辑:简化中断服务程序的逻辑,减少不必要的计算和操作,以提高响应速度和处理效率。
3. 使用高效的数据结构:通过合理组织数据在内存中的布局,使用p快速访问和修改数据,提高数据处理的速度和准确性。
4. 培训和提升技能:对PLC编程人员进行培训和技能提升,使其熟练掌握PLC中断服务和p的使用技巧,提高系统的整体性能。

六、结论

本文探讨了程序段中的PLC中断服务及其中的p的含义。
通过深入了解PLC中断服务的原理和p的作用,我们可以更好地利用PLC的中断功能,提高系统的实时性和响应速度。
同时,通过优化PLC中断服务和提高p的使用效率,我们可以进一步提高PLC的性能,为工业控制系统的发展做出贡献。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论